Who doesn\'t appreciate a freebie? But the real magic happens when people want to keep the free stuff you give them. Think about the pen with a logo on it that you got at a trade fair or the tote bag that you got at a community function. You probably use both of them all the time. That's the magic of promotional products: they do a lot of work for your brand without making a lot of noise.
Giving out branded things has this one thing: You want them to be helpful. A cheap pen might seem like a nice idea at first, but who actually wants to use it? No, probably not. It gets lost at the bottom of a drawer. But a product that is well-made and of great quality that people can use every day? That will catch people's attention. The most important thing is to make your giveaway valuable. People will remember your brand if you give them something helpful, like a nice notebook, a stylish water bottle, or a phone charger. Let's be honest: most of us see digital adverts all day long. They come up, bother us, then go away in a hurry. But what about promotional items? They are real. You may find them on desks, in kitchens, and on the go. People talk to them every day. And your brand is always there, whether it's on a coffee mug, a reusable bag, or even a pair of Bluetooth headphones. It's like having a subtle, soft reminder helpful hints of your business that doesn't shout for attention but yet gets noticed. But don't just choose the first thing that comes to mind. These days, eco-friendly items are very popular. A bamboo toothbrush or a reusable shopping bag with your logo on it not only gets your name out there, but it also indicates that you care about the environment. That's something people notice. It's a simple approach to score extra points with your viewers. One great thing about promotional things is that they last. An ad may only last a second, but something useful stays around. Your brand sticks with consumers long after the event is over, whether it's a tote bag they take to the shop or a water bottle they take to the gym. The perfect promotional item will help your business stay prominent without being too pushy. It's not enough to just give things out; you have to make a relationship. The more time and effort you put into your giveaways, the longer they will work for you once the event is done. When you want to get your brand out there, don't just run an ad. Give people something they can genuinely use instead. You'll see how different it is.
